Neighborhood Overview

McHattie Park is situated conveniently near the downtown core of South Lyon, making it highly accessible for visitors arriving from major Michigan regional corridors. The venue is easily reached via I-96 or US-23, which funnel traffic toward the city center. Once you arrive in the vicinity, the park is located just off Warren Street, offering centralized access for teams and spectators alike. Parking is available on-site, though it can become quite busy during peak tournament hours or weekend events. We recommend arriving early to secure a spot, as local traffic can intensify near the entrance during transition times.

Most visitors arrive by personal vehicle, as the region lacks extensive public transit infrastructure. Rideshare services like Uber and Lyft are available, but they are less frequent than in major metropolitan hubs, so schedule accordingly. If you are flying into the area, Detroit Metropolitan Airport (DTW) is the primary gateway, typically requiring a 45-minute drive depending on traffic. Once settled, the proximity to South Lyon's downtown area allows for easy movement between the fields and local dining options. Planning your arrival for at least 45 minutes before your scheduled start time is a smart tactic to account for parking and gear transport.

Where to Stay

While South Lyon itself has limited large-scale hotel options, visitors typically look toward the neighboring hubs of Novi, Brighton, or Ann Arbor for a broader selection of accommodations. These areas provide a mix of reliable chain hotels that cater well to traveling teams and large groups needing multiple rooms. If you prefer to be close to the action, there are smaller lodging options within a short driving radius of the park. Most teams choose to stay in the Novi area due to the easy highway access and abundance of family-oriented amenities.

During major sports tournaments, demand for rooms can spike significantly across the region, so booking your accommodations as early as possible is essential. We recommend checking for team-friendly hotels that offer breakfast and proximity to major thoroughfares to simplify your morning commute. If you are traveling during high-season weekends, consider expanding your search to Brighton to find better availability. Always confirm if your selected hotel has space for team meeting areas or equipment storage, as this can make your stay much more comfortable.

Local Tips

Arrive early: Parking lots fill up fast on tournament weekends so aim to arrive well before your first game.

Bring shade: The fields have limited natural shade so bring your own canopy or umbrellas for between-game comfort.

Check weather: Michigan weather changes quickly so pack layers and rain gear to be prepared for any conditions.

Caravan strategy: Coordinate carpools to reduce the number of vehicles you need to park at the crowded venue site.

Downtown walk: Use the short path to downtown for better dining variety than what is available at the park.

Seasonal note: South Lyon is a vibrant destination in the spring and summer when youth sports tournaments are in full swing. The area feels busy and energetic during these months, with many families traveling through for competitions. Autumn brings cooler temperatures and beautiful foliage, making it a pleasant time for outdoor events, though travel remains steady. Winter is much quieter, as most field-based activities move indoors. Visitors can expect easy travel during the off-season, but should prepare for winter driving conditions.

Weather & Seasons

❄️

Winter

Winter in Michigan is cold and snowy, with temperatures frequently dropping below freezing. Outdoor activities at the park are non-existent during this time, so plan for indoor alternatives. Ensure you have a heavy coat, gloves, and boots if traveling during these months for indoor tournament play.

🌱

Spring & early summer

This is the primary season for sports in South Lyon, characterized by mild to warm temperatures. Mornings can still be crisp, so dressing in layers is the best approach for long days at the field. Keep an eye on local forecasts as occasional spring showers are quite common.

☀️

Mid-summer

Expect hot and humid conditions throughout the peak summer months. It is essential to stay hydrated and take advantage of any available shade during your time at the complex. Light, breathable clothing and high-SPF sunscreen are absolute necessities for everyone spending the day outside.

🍂

Fall season

Fall provides some of the most comfortable weather for outdoor sports, with crisp air and plenty of sunshine. Temperatures are ideal for athletes, though evenings can turn cool very quickly. A light jacket or fleece is recommended for spectators who plan to stay through the late afternoon.

📅

Rain & snow

Rain can occur at any time during the spring and summer, occasionally causing delays to tournament schedules. Always pack a reliable rain jacket and extra socks for the kids. If you are visiting late in the fall, be prepared for potential early-season snow flurries during your stay.
